A Transient Historical past of the Metric System

The metric system, established in 1791, launched the idea of base-10 models to simplify measurements. Milliliters and liters originated from this method, with milliliters being a smaller unit of 1/a thousandth of a liter. The metric system’s decimal construction simplifies models of measurement, making it an environment friendly system for worldwide commerce and science.

Liter to Milliliter Conversion Desk

| Liters | Milliliters || — | — || 1 L | 1000 mL || 2 L | 2000 mL || 3 L | 3000 mL || 4 L | 4000 mL || 5 L | 5000 mL |

Utilizing on a regular basis objects to make tough estimates

Whereas it isn’t advisable to rely solely on on a regular basis objects for exact measurements, this stuff will be useful for making tough estimates. Listed below are some examples:

Object Approximate mL quantity
Teaspoon (US) 5 mL
Tablespoon (US) 15 mL
Cup (US) 240 mL

Consumer Queries

What’s the distinction between milliliters and liters?

Milliliters are a smaller unit of measurement, equal to one-thousandth of a liter.

How do I convert milliliters to liters?

To transform milliliters to liters, merely divide the variety of milliliters by 1,000.
